ABOUT JESUS "CHUNGO" GALEAS
Jesus has played a vital role in motivating his community to focus on specialty microlot coffee, largely through his seven years with the Honduran Coffee Institute (IHCAFE). There, he supported farmers across the country with soil analysis, harvesting, and processing, always aiming to inspire them to adopt better practices and pursue specialty coffee.
In 2018, this work led him to connect with former IHCAFE colleague Rony Gamez, who had founded Café Raga to provide technical support to specialty producers. Jesus brought Rony samples from Selguapa, and from just two interested farmers, the Los Ramirez group quickly grew to 30 producers in a single year.
Jesus now farms in Selguapa at La Falda and in Intibuca at La Valeria, a farm he inherited at 17. Starting with one manzana in 2010, he expanded it to 5 hectares through hard work and loans, planting Pacamara, Catuai, Paraneima, Bourbon, and IH-90.
